Beginner’s Guide To Calorie Counting: Eat Right To Lose Weight

Calorie counting is a common diet practice allowing individuals to track the number of calories they consume and subsequently burn. Counting calories is an efficient way for one to track their exercises and diet to lose, maintain, or gain weight. There is a lot of math and tracking that goes along with it, but luckily plenty of free apps can make this job much easier to handle.

How Many Calories To Eat Per Day?

How many calories need to be consumed each day is dependent on the individual’s gender, age, height, weight, and their weight goals. It has been reported the average woman should consume two thousand calories per day to maintain her weight, and 1,500 calories per day to lose one pound each week. Similarly, the average man should consume 2,500 calories to maintain his weight, and two thousand calories to lose one pound per week. However, these are only averages and may vary from every individual.

Which Exercises Burn The Most Calories?

Cardiovascular exercises do the best job at burning calories quickly and keeping an individual healthy. Jogging is one of the most popular cardio exercises, and an individual weighing 155 pounds, running at six miles per hour, can burn 744 calories per hour. Another favorite cardio exercise is biking. Bikers who keep a steady speed of five mph can expect to burn 598 calories, and up to 746 if biking uphill. But which cardio workout burns the most calories? Rock climbing. That’s right: rock climbing can burn up to 818 calories per hour. Keep in mind all calories burned were using a test subject weighing 155 pounds.
